Description
Angular distribution of the 40Ca(α, d)42Sc reaction at Esub(α) = 40 MeV have been measured for states in 42Sc up to an excitation energy of 5.2 MeV. Assignments of the L-transfer are made on the basis of the characteristic shapes of the angular distributions. A strong L = 6 transisiton to a state at 3.61 MeV in the 42Sc is observed. Evidence for the fragmentation of the (fsub(7/2)250 and (fsub(7/2)psub(3/2)50 configurations into the 5+ states at 1.51 and 3.09 MeV is discussed. (Auth.)
